WebThe administrator, personal representative, or executor changes his/her name or address. Trusts. You will be required to obtain a new EIN if the following statements are true: One person is the grantor/maker of many trusts. A trust changes to an estate. A living or intervivos trust changes to a testamentary trust.

Report all income sources on your 1040 return, whether or... how does commercial health insurance workWebOct 5, 2024 · The IRS lists three steps to becoming an enrolled agent: Obtain a PTIN through the IRS. Schedule and pass the EA licensing exam. Candidates can then apply for enrollment through the IRS website. Undergo a background check. Background checks look at income tax history and any criminal background.
